## Formula sandbox tuning

User-supplied formulas in Gridmoor execute inside a restricted interpreter with hard ceilings on time, memory, and call depth. Reviewers should confirm any change to these ceilings is justified in the PR description, since raising them widens the abuse surface. Defaults were chosen from production traces. The current limits are as follows.

limits module of tafog-fawip:
WEIGHTS = {
    "julix": 57,
    "lamys": 992,
    "kasvan": 209,
    "quenok": 750,
    "alddor": 259,
    "oliath": 1009,
    "wenix": 815,
}

## Runbook addendum — stale-cache fix (v4.2.1)

Per the Ledgewick postmortem, the patched cache invalidation must ship as a signed hotfix. Reviewer: confirm the TTL change in the diff matches the postmortem action item before approving. Build via the standard pipeline, then tag as hotfix. The artifact must be signed prior to rollout with the key below.

deploy key for kajof-fajop: bky6_gDHw9Q

# Pindiff env — large-file diff viewer.
# New contractor notes: keep it short.
# CHUNK_SIZE_MB controls how files are split before diffing. Default 32.
# MAX_FILE_GB caps upload size; raise only with infra approval.
# RENDER_MODE: "virtual" for the virtualized scroller, "paged" otherwise.
# CACHE_DIR must be on local SSD, not NFS. Diffs thrash otherwise.
# WORKER_COUNT: match core count minus one.
# Never commit this file with real values.
# The worker auth secret goes on the line directly below.

sealed setting: ARCHIVE_KEY3=8d0

**14:22 UTC** — Autocomplete latency on the Norvex search tier climbed past 900ms p95. On-call confirmed the suggestion index had fallen behind after the overnight reindex job on the Tamsin cluster stalled mid-shard. We throttled writes, restarted the indexer, and latency recovered by 14:51. Root cause traced to a memory ceiling introduced in the prior week's deploy; the fix is queued for Thursday. For the sync, the offending deploy is identified by the build token recorded below.

session token of bajog-tadup = htk3_ffc